10 Cleaning Hacks That Truly Work (Cleaner-Approved)
1. Dry first, wet second (always)
Dust, crumbs, hair, and grit should never meet liquid. Vacuum, sweep, or dry wipe first or youโll just smear grime.
2. Dwell time beats elbow grease
Spray โ wait โ wipe.
Most cleaners fail because people rush them. Chemistry does the work when you let it sit.
3. The 4-towel method for streak-free surfaces
โข Towel 1: clean & wet
โข Towel 2: rinse
โข Towel 3: dry
โข Towel 4: final polish
This is why pros donโt get streaks.
4. Top-to-bottom is non-negotiable
Fans โ shelves โ counters โ floors.
Anything else = re-cleaning twice.
5. Use the right pH (not โmore productโ)
Grease โ soap scum โ mineral buildup.
Matching the cleaner to the soil saves time and prevents damage.
6. Steam replaces scrubbing
Heat breaks bonds grime holds onto surfaces. Showers, grout, stove buildup steam first, wipe second.
7. Agitation matters more than product
A brush, scrub pad, or microfiber with texture will outperform any โmiracleโ spray alone.
8. Work in zones, not rooms
Clean one zone completely (ex: sink area) before moving on.
This reduces overwhelm and increases efficiency.
9. Squeegee glass & pet hair
โข Shower doors: instant streak-free finish
โข Carpets & stairs: pulls embedded pet hair vacuums miss
10. Finish with prevention
Dry surfaces, buff stainless, wipe baseboardsprevention keeps things clean longer and cuts future work in half.
